Thatching is the process of getting rid of the layer of dead yard, roots, and natural debris that collects between the soil and living turf, which can hamper water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can result in shallow root systems, increased insect problems, and uneven growth. Methods for thatching consist of handbook raking or making use of specialized dethatching equipment that lifts and eliminates the layer without harmful healthy grass The process is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Regular thatching guarantees much better soil-to-grass contact, boosts nutrient uptake, and maintains a lush, durable yard. Including thatching into yard care regimens enhances both the look and long-term health of turf.
